Tasting review

Show more Show less

Eye: A wonderfully rich burnt caramel color.

Nose: Its rancio nose is thanks to its many years ageing in oak casks, a smooth and harmonious bouquet. The second nose delivers countless aromas that develop and intensify.

Palate: A round mouthfeel with a nice, soft finish. It's exceptionally long-lingering finish is an irrefutable pledge of its quality.

Description

Take Home a Piece of History with Tesseron Extreme Cognac

Tesseron Extrême, a Grande Champagne blend that is considered “Hors d'Age”, is a Cognac that will undoubtedly delight the few that get to taste it. This is the first time this exceptional blend of ancient treasures, hidden within Tesseron's “Paradis” Cellar for many years, has been put on sale. It is so rare that even specialists and high end collectors are talking about it only as a memory of flavors long sought after and never found...

The Tesseron Extreme really is something special. A collectors item and rare pearl, it is a piece of history and a celebration of the craftsmanship and heritage that the four generations of the Tesseron family have brought to the world of Cognac. Created by cellar master and master blender Jacky Martial, this Cognac contains a harmonious marriage of eaux-de-vie that have been carefully selected over a year long process, with some boasting ages of over 100 years old.

Extreme has been created from a secret blend of 10 eaux-de-vie, with the oldest being from 1853!

This Cognac is velvety and supple on the palate, a smooth sensory experience that is testament to its aging process and high quality. Surprisingly mellow despite its complex depth of flavors that intensify and develop with every sip. Only 300 decanters of this extraordinary Cognac are produced every year, a product so rare that connoisseurs the world over are hunting far and wide to get their hands on a bottle.

The Tesseron Cognac estate deals exclusively in Cognac's of XO age and above. Their collection of rare and prestigious Cognacs stored in the "paradis" cellars of the estate were first stored there by none other than Abel Tesseron himself when the House was founded in 1905. This legacy and tradition has been passed down through four generations, with the Maison now ran by Mélanie Tesseron.

What makes Tesseron so sought after is not only the high-quality eaux-de-vie and the exquisite presentation of its bottle design, but the story that is sold with it. The "paradis" cellars at Tesseron are in fact a former crypt of a 12th century abbey, creating a unique atmosphere for the maturation process that is rich in history and tradition. The cellars are protected using guard dogs, this is understandable when you realise some of their oldest cognacs have been there for over 175 years!

Presentation of the Bottle

This unique creation comes in a small, wax-sealed, 1.75 litre "dame-jeanne" (demijohn), reminiscent of the famous 25 litre demijohns that store the finest eaux-de-vie used to produce this masterful Cognac.

Presented to you nestled in a beautiful lacquered box, the Tesseron Extreme is not only a treat for the tastebuds, but on the eyes as well. An exceptionally rare work of art, valued amongst professional and domestic Cognac experts alike.

About Tesseron Cognac

Tesseron Cognac specializes in high-end Cognac, exclusively producing “XO and beyond” blends from their ancestral home in Chateauneuf-sur-Charente, which lies between Cognac and Angouleme. When founder Abel Tesseron, whose face features on the company’s logo, acquired the property in the late 19th century, he patiently conserved his stocks of eaux-de-vie in the 12th-century crypt located deep underneath the domain, selling his matured masterpieces to various larger Cognac houses. These reserved and rare stocks have become legendary amongst Cognac connoisseurs the world over. It was, however, only in 2003 that the fourth generation of Tesserons made the decision to release a range under their own name, armed with an unrivalled Cognac craftsmanship and fueled by the legacy left by their grandfather, the iconic brand Tesseron Cognac was born. 

The Tesserons are also active in wine production, owning the esteemed Chateau Pontet-Canet, a Pauillac classified property producing Grand Cru Classé Bordeaux Wine.
